[BUGFIX] Account owner should not be clickable & [Refactor] Chip.tsx links (#10359)
# Introduction closes #10196 Initially fixing the `Account Owner` record field value should not be clickable and redirects on current page bug. This has been fixed computing whereas the current filed is a workspace member dynamically rendering a stale Chip components instead of an interactive one ## Refactor Refactored the `AvatarChip` `to` props logic to be scoped to lower level scope `Chip`. Now we have `LinkChip` `Chip`, `LinkAvatarChip` and `AvatarChip` all exported from twenty-ui. The caller has to determine which one to call from the design system ## New rule regarding chip links As discussed with @charlesBochet and @FelixMalfait A chip link will now ***always*** have `to` defined. ( and optionally an `onClick` ). `ChipLinks` cannot be used as buttons anymore ## Factorization Deleted the `RecordIndexRecordChip.tsx` file ( aka `RecordIdentifierChip` component ) that was duplicating some logic, refactored the `RecordChip` in order to handle what was covered by `RecordIdentifierChip` ## Conclusion As always any suggestions are more than welcomed !
